Tony Threatt holding two offers

Tony Threatt recently received a scholarship offer from the University of South Alabama; he tells JagsJungle the latest news in recruiting.
“I received an offer from USA last week,”
Tony Threatt
told us from his home in Leeds (Ala).
“I liked Coach Jones a lot and I like South Alabama. He (Coach Joey Jones) told me I had a full ride down there, which is very good. I am going to visit their campus this summer- they were telling me about how everything was first class down there,” Threatt stated.
“I think it would be pretty cool to be a part of their first ever recruiting class down there. I would like to leave my mark on the team for future players if I were to go there.”
Tony tells us how the Jags recognized his talent.
“They were at my school talking to Coach Etheredge about
Travis Grandy
and Coach Etheredge gave them a DVD of me. The next week they called my school and offered me a scholarship,” Threatt recalled.
Tony Threatt also reported USA has offered 2008 Leeds graduate, Travis Grundy, a scholarship.
“South Alabama offered Travis but he isn’t sure what he’s going to do, yet.”
Tony Threatt received another offer from the Black Knights the same week South Alabama offered and he is happy to be holding two offers.
“Army offered me the same week they offered
Randon Carnathan
,” he recalled. “Their recruiter came by our school to talk to a small group of players about their academics and our service after our education and football. When he finished talking to us he pulled Randon and me to the side and offered us both a full scholarship.”
Tony Threatt isn’t finished with his recruitment just yet. He has several other schools interested in his talent as a 6-4, 190 pound safety/wide receiver prospect.
“I am still hearing from Alabama, Auburn, Kentucky, Tennessee, Middle Tennessee, Citadel, Army, South Alabama and La. Tech.”
“La. Tech has been to see me twice at school and they have asked me for all kinds of information. I think they might be close to offering me,” Threatt explained. “I also went to the Nike Combine at Alabama last weekend and I enjoyed it a lot. I also learned a lot of things I need to work on before season starts,” Threatt concluded.
